The Silhouette is a 17.25ft masthead sloop designed by Robert Tucker and built in plywood or fiberglass by Hurley Marine Ltd. between 1954 and 1986.

2600 units have been built.

The Silhouette is a moderate weight sailboat which is a very high performer. It is stable / stiff and has a low righting capability if capsized. It is best suited as a racing boat.
